Operation Yellow Ribbon: Canada and 9/11
GeoHistory
GeoLiteracy
Lesson Plan Content
Description:
In this lesson, students will gain a better understanding of how Canada aided the United States during the crisis of 9/11.
Author:
Dennis Rees
Grade Range:
7-High School
Duration:
2 class periods
